Soda Cracker Torte
📜 Collection: GC | ✍️ Attribution: Unknown | 📂 Category: Desserts A classic, vintage torte with a unique, chewy texture and rich nutty flavor. This flourless dessert gets its structure from crushed soda crackers and beaten egg whites.
| Prep Time | Cook Time | Inactive / Chill Time | Yield / Servings |
|---|---|---|---|
| 15 mins | 30 mins | None | 8 servings |
🔪 Key Equipment
- 9-inch pie plate
- Round cake pan
- Medium bowl
- Clean bowl
- Electric mixer
Ingredients
| Measurements | Ingredients | Prep / Notes |
|---|---|---|
| 3 large | Eggs | Separated |
| 1 cup | Sugar | None |
| 3/4 cup | Nuts | Chopped, such as walnuts or pecans |
| 3/4 cup | Soda Crackers | Finely crushed, about 18-20 crackers |
| 1/2 teaspoon | Baking Powder | None |
| Dash | Salt | None |
For Serving
| Measurements | Ingredients | Prep / Notes |
|---|---|---|
| As needed | Jam | Tart, optional |
| As needed | Whipped Cream | Optional |
| As needed | Fruit | Fresh, optional |
Instructions
Step 1: Prep and Batter Base
- Preheat your oven to 350°F. Grease a 9-inch pie plate or round cake pan.
- In a medium bowl, combine the 3 large Eggs (yolks only), 1 cup Sugar, 3/4 cup chopped Nuts, 3/4 cup crushed Soda Crackers, 1/2 teaspoon Baking Powder, and a dash of Salt. Mix well until thoroughly combined.
Step 2: Whip and Fold
- In a separate, clean bowl, beat the remaining 3 large Eggs (whites only) with an electric mixer until stiff peaks form.
- Gently fold the beaten egg whites into the yolk mixture in three additions until just combined and no white streaks remain.
Step 3: Bake and Serve
- Pour the batter into the greased pan or pie plate.
- Bake for 30 minutes until the torte will puff up and be golden brown.
- Let the torte cool completely in the pan.
- To serve, spread with tart Jam or top with Whipped Cream and fresh Fruit.
💡 Make-Ahead & Storage: Store the cooled torte tightly covered at room temperature for up to 2 days, or refrigerate for up to 4 days.
